When doctors place a breathing tube for surgery, it can temporarily raise pressure in your brain and cause blood pressure spikes—especially risky if you're already very ill. This trial tests four medications—lidocaine, dexmedetomidine, esmolol, and magnesium—to see which one best prevents these harmful changes. Researchers will measure how well each medication protects your brain during this procedure using a simple ultrasound of the optic nerve.
Breathing tube placement triggers a stress response in your body that can be dangerous for patients who are critically ill or at risk of brain swelling. Finding a safe, effective medication to prevent this response could protect vulnerable patients and improve their outcomes.
You will be randomly assigned to receive one of the four medications or a placebo (salt water) as an intravenous infusion 10 minutes before your breathing tube is placed. The study team will monitor your brain pressure using a simple ultrasound of your eye nerve and track your blood pressure and heart rate during the procedure. You will not know which medication or placebo you received (this is 'blinded'), and neither will your doctors—this keeps the results fair and unbiased.
